"Make sure you get the right door at this downtown locals’ delight; the 515 Bar is attached to both a youth hostel and the cheerful sports bar Malone’s. (You’ll have to wander through both other businesses to find the bathrooms, which can be extra challenging after a few rounds of deliciously strong cocktails.) 515 knocks it out of the park with a decidedly European vibe, pairing craft cocktails with a truly superb Indie retro playlist and the most generous cheese and charcuterie plate in the city, from legendary cheesemongers Les Amis du Fromage. It’s wildly popular, and queues are known to form for the daily happy hour (4 - 6 p.m.) on Fridays and Saturdays. Must try drink: Top-shelf, ice cold martinis with Castelvetrano olives are a bargain during happy hour." - Nikki Bayley
